Reproduction
| Question | Answer |
|---|---|
| Primary sex characteristics | are physical differences between the male and the female reproductive organs |
| Secondary sex characteristics | are not directly related to reproduction |
| Secondary sex characteristics appear | in puberty |
| The two types of humans reproductives cells are | female (egg cells) and male (sperm cells) |
| Fertilisation is | when the egg cell joins with a sperm cell |
| Reproductives cells are also called | gametes |
| Puberty start | in girls between the ages of 8-14 and in boys between the ages of 9-15 |
| An egg cells is released | every 28 days |
| The female reproductive system | has two ovaries |
| The male reproductive system | has two testicles |
| After Fertilization | a zygote is formed |
| The ovaries stop releasing egg cells | between 45-55 years old |
| the female cell membrain has the function | of stopping sperm cells entering the egg cells after fertilization |
| Egg cells are formed | in the ovaries |
| The sperm cells are formed | in the testicles |
